Biography

Bauke Visser is a full professor of economics at the Erasmus School of Economics, Erasmus University Rotterdam. He holds a Master of Science in Econometrics, graduating cum laude from the University of Groningen, and a PhD from the European University Institute in Florence, Italy. He joined Erasmus University in 2000, after a two-year position in corporate planning and strategy at Royal Dutch Shell. He served as director of the Tinbergen Institute from 2011 to 2015, a research institute affiliated with the graduate school of economics and business faculties of both Erasmus University Rotterdam and VU University Amsterdam. A member and chair of the Taskforce on Scientific Integrity at Erasmus University, he is also a Fernand Braudel senior fellow at the European University Institute, where he conducted research on decision-making processes and governance. His teaching focuses on applied game theory, decision-making processes, and governance. Visser's research interests include networks, complexity, and their implications in economics, as reflected in his publications in leading economic journals.
